How Reliable is the Toyota Prius?

Based on 1,959,742 MOT tests across 148,686 vehicles.

81.8%
Pass Rate
12,199
Miles/Year
22
Year Lifespan
148,686
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 14,116
position lamp(s) not working 9,474
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 9,244
Registration plate lamp not working 9,122

L2 ERJ is a 2008 Toyota Prius in Black with a 1,497cc hybrid electric (clean) eng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 2008 Toyota Prius models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.1% with a typical mileage of 95,270 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Toyota Prius f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 14,116 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L2 ERJ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Toyota Prius typ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 18 years old, this Toyota Prius is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
